Kiley was born and raised in Regina, Saskatchewan. Following graduation from high school she attended Montana State University where she completed a Bachelor of Science in Exercise Physiology. Upon graduation, Kiley became certified as an Exercise Physiologist with the Canadian Society of Exercise Physiology. The lure of the mountains and sports that were readily available fit well with her athletic pursuits kept her in Montana for 7 years before returning to Saskatchewan. A mother of 2 beautiful girls, owner of Stapleford Health and Rehab Clinic, athletic dabbler who has with a life long passion of helping others find their “best self”. Her experience spans over 30 years of dedication to a wide range of clients of all ages from professional athletes to those struggling with orthopaedic injuries. Kiley is committed to maintaining current with the needs of her clients by ever evolving personally and professionally by continuing to learn as she “grows up”.
Area of Speciality include:
The Ready State Level 1, 2 Mobility Coach Kinstretch Instructor Spin Instructor FRC Certified FMS Certified Gait analysis Regional rehabilitation programs Life Coach

Sophia attended the University of Alberta where she obtained a bachelor’s degree in Kinesiology. Upon graduation, Sophia became certified as an Exercise Physiologist with the Canadian Society of Exercise Physiology and moved from her home in Alberta to Regina. Her experience varies from: athletic development, chronic diseases, orthopedic injuries, neurological rehab, children, and elderly populations. She has a passion for working with clients’ unique goals to develop personalized, functional and fun programs.
Certifications: - Functional Capacity Evaluation - The Ready State Certified Movement and Mobility Specialist - CETI Certified Cancer Exercise Specialist

Jen Ruland, a seasoned Exercise Physiologist and Long Distance Running Coach with over two decades of expertise in cardiac rehabilitation, chronic disease management, and exercise therapy. Jen’s journey began with a solid academic foundation from the University of Regina, propelling her into a career marked by a profound dedication to health enhancement and performance optimization through movement and endurance.
Jen’s career commenced in 2005 as an Exercise Physiologist, specializing in cardiac conditions, chronic diseases, and orthopedic injuries. Her credentials include certifications from prestigious bodies such as the American College of Sports Medicine and the Cancer Exercise Training Institute, along with expertise in Functional Movement Systems and Keiser Cycling. These qualifications underscore Jen’s comprehensive approach to client care and training.
